发布时间:2024-09-26 浏览量:
游戏**
在当今瞬息万变的数字世界中,HTML5 游戏已成为一种流行且可访问的方式,可提供引人入
胜且令人满意的游戏体验。对于希望打造自己的 HTML5 小游戏的开发者,重要的是掌握最佳实践并了解整个开发过程。
**1. 规划和构思**
从明确的游戏目标和受众开始。考虑游戏类型、机制和玩法。沐鸣平台注册沐鸣娱乐游戏说:创建故事板或流程图以
可视化游戏流程,确保流畅的游戏体验。
**2. 图形和动画**
利用 HTML5 Canvas 元素创建自定义图形。沐鸣娱乐游戏以为:使用基于 CSS 的动画和 WebGL 等技术增强游戏中的动态效果。优化图形以确保快速加载和流畅的性能。
**3. 代码和逻辑**
编写清晰、高效的 JavaScript 代码。采用面向对象的编程技术来组织游戏逻辑和代码维护。沐鸣娱乐游戏以为:实现游戏机制、玩家控制和事件处理程序。
**4. 音频和声音效果**
集成音频和声音效果,以增强游戏体验。使用 HTML5 Audio 元素播放音乐和音
效,并动态管理它们以创建沉浸式氛围。
**5. 物理和碰撞检测**
在游戏中实现物理效果,例如重力、碰撞和运动。利用 HTML5 的 requestAnimationFrame API 进行平稳的动画和精准的物理仿真。
**6. 用户交互**
提供用户友好的交互,例如点击、拖放和键盘控制。沐鸣娱乐游戏以为:设计直观的 UI 元素,让玩家轻松控制游戏。
**7. 响应式设计**
确保游戏在不同设备和屏幕尺寸上都能正常运行。采用媒体查询和 CSS 响应式技术来调整布局和图形,以获得最佳观看体验。
**8. 测试和调试**
彻底测试游戏以识别错误和性能问题。使用浏览器控制台和调试工具来诊断问题和优化游戏性能。
**9. 部署和分发**
选择合适的部署平台,例如 GitHub Pages 或 itch.io。优化游戏的加载时间和文件大小,以确保流畅的游戏体验。
****
遵循这些最佳实践,你可以打造引人入胜且令人难忘的 HTML5 小游戏。沐鸣娱乐游戏以为:通过规划、优化代码、实施交互和利用 HTML5 的强大功能,你可以创建迷你游戏,为玩家带来
乐趣和满足感。沐鸣平台官方网站沐鸣娱乐游戏说:不断学习新技术和趋势,以跟上不断发展的游戏开发领域。